Vice President JD Vance on Tuesday defended his personal stock trading transactions disclosed in recent financial filings, responding with "Come on, man" to critics while also stating that he and President Donald Trump both support banning congressional stock trading. The remarks come amid renewed scrutiny of lawmakers' and executive branch officials' financial activities.

He defended the transactions, dismissing criticism with a casual "Come on, man" when pressed by reporters. Vance also expressed support for a legislative ban on stock trading by members of Congress, aligning with President Donald Trump's position. "The president and I both agree that members of Congress should not be trading stocks while they have access to non-public information and shape policy that could affect those investments," Vance said. The financial filings, released within the past few weeks, showed a series of stock trades by Vance. He did not provide specific details about the trades during the press conference but emphasized that all transactions were conducted in compliance with existing ethics rules and disclosure requirements. The issue of congressional stock trading has gained traction in recent months, with bipartisan calls for tighter restrictions. Vance’s comments mark the first time he has publicly addressed the matter since the filings were made public. Analysts suggest that such statements may indicate a shift in political will toward stricter rules, but translating that into law remains uncertain. Ethics experts note that while executive branch officials are subject to different conflict-of-interest rules than members of Congress, the growing public scrutiny could prompt voluntary restrictions or executive orders. Some observers caution that without specific legislative proposals, the support for a ban may remain largely rhetorical. For investors, the ongoing debate does not directly impact market dynamics, but it could affect sectors where regulatory oversight is tightening. Any eventual ban on stock trading for lawmakers would likely have minimal direct effect on financial markets, but could reduce perceptions of unfair advantage among market participants. Overall, the episode underscores the delicate balance between public service and private financial activities, with potential implications for how both politicians and traders approach transparency and trust in the financial system.
